in the USARutgers University Newark is a medium-sized public college offering a number of disciplines along with the accounting program and located in
Newark,
New Jersey. This college was opened in 1946 and is currently offering bachelor's and master's degrees in Accounting.
Rutgers University Newark is expensive: tuition cost is about $36,000 a year. If you seek a cheaper alternative, check
Affordable Colleges in New Jersey listing.
According to recent studies, Rutgers University Newark area is relatively dangerous; the school is reported to have
a poor rating for on-campus security.
